Output 6407df844a43ce669173eb25e51ca8040272b523adbd35c66fdf62d1650e0e92:1

value
985151
script pubkey
OP_0 OP_PUSHBYTES_20 262c2b0d87b92a450528de7807c28747de52387c
address
bc1qyckzkrv8hy4y2pfgmeuq0s58gl09ywruk058u2
transaction
6407df844a43ce669173eb25e51ca8040272b523adbd35c66fdf62d1650e0e92
confirmations
196684
spent
true